Form.ShowInTaskbar Propriedade

Definição

Obtém ou define um valor que indica se o formulário é exibido na barra de tarefas do Windows.

public:
 property bool ShowInTaskbar { bool get(); void set(bool value); };
public bool ShowInTaskbar { get; set; }
member this.ShowInTaskbar : bool with get, set
Public Property ShowInTaskbar As Boolean

Valor da propriedade

true para exibir o formulário na barra de tarefas do Windows no tempo de execução; caso contrário, false. O padrão é true.

Exemplos

O exemplo a seguir demonstra como usar a ShowInTaskbar propriedade para criar uma caixa de diálogo que não é exibida na barra de tarefas do Windows.

private:
   void ShowInTaskBarEx()
   {
      Form^ myForm = gcnew Form;
      myForm->Text = "My Form";
      myForm->SetBounds( 10, 10, 200, 200 );
      myForm->FormBorderStyle = ::FormBorderStyle::FixedDialog;
      myForm->MinimizeBox = false;
      myForm->MaximizeBox = false;

      // Do not allow form to be displayed in taskbar.
      myForm->ShowInTaskbar = false;
      myForm->ShowDialog();
   }
private void ShowInTaskBarEx()
{
    Form myForm = new Form();
    myForm.Text = "My Form";
    myForm.SetBounds(10,10,200,200);
    myForm.FormBorderStyle = FormBorderStyle.FixedDialog;
    myForm.MinimizeBox = false;
    myForm.MaximizeBox = false;
    // Do not allow form to be displayed in taskbar.
    myForm.ShowInTaskbar = false;
    myForm.ShowDialog();
}
Private Sub ShowInTaskBarEx()
    Dim myForm As New Form()
    myForm.Text = "My Form"
    myForm.SetBounds(10, 10, 200, 200)
    myForm.FormBorderStyle = FormBorderStyle.FixedDialog
    myForm.MinimizeBox = False
    myForm.MaximizeBox = False
    ' Do not allow form to be displayed in taskbar.
    myForm.ShowInTaskbar = False
    myForm.ShowDialog()
End Sub

Comentários

Se um formulário for pai em outro formulário, o formulário pai não será exibido na barra de tarefas do Windows.

Você pode usar essa propriedade para impedir que os usuários selecionem seu formulário por meio da barra de tarefas do Windows. Por exemplo, se você exibir uma janela de ferramenta Localizar e Substituir em seu aplicativo, convém impedir que essa janela seja selecionada por meio da barra de tarefas do Windows, pois você precisaria da janela principal do aplicativo e da janela da ferramenta Localizar e Substituir exibida para processar pesquisas adequadamente.

Muitas vezes, você desejará usar essa propriedade ao criar um formulário com o FixedToolWindow estilo . Definir o FixedToolWindow estilo não garante apenas que uma janela não será exibida na barra de tarefas.

Aplica-se a